Data as of January 2026. Source: Realtor.com.
The Clay County, West Virginia real estate market currently shows 17 active listings, with 7 pending sales. Homes are averaging 117.1 days on the market before going under contract.
Inventory has increased compared to last year, with 4 more homes available — giving buyers more choice.
Homes are taking longer to sell, averaging 117.1 days on market compared to 100.4 days last year.
The median listing price has fallen 45.7% year-over-year, from $290,500 to $157,700.
